PS Vita Firmware 2.00 will make it possible for users to switch to the web browser without quitting out of games, Sony Computer Entertainment Worldwide Studios boss Shuhei Yoshida has revealed on Twitter.
“One welcome change in tomorrow’s PS Vita FW2.0 will be the web browser becomes a ‘small app’, you won’t have to quit games to use it,” wrote Yoshida.
“That’s little talked about but is a big change, and the browsing itself is faster than the current one :)”
Version 2.00 will be released in Europe on Wednesday, coinciding with the launch of PlayStation Plus which offers members access to Uncharted: Golden Abyss, Gravity Rush, Chronovolt and Tales from Space: Mutant Blobs Attack. Members will also get discounts of a selection of other titles.
